On the ash-solid panel, click "Change/Create" and put in another name & density. Then "OK". Do NOT overwrite, you now have two particle materials. Copy injection-0 and on the new injection use the new material, mass flow etc.
You've used a size distribution. That's OK to add particles to the domain, but less simple to figure out what went where. By having multiple injections you can set particle size and material to suit.
Depending on particle mass loading you may, or may not need to couple the particles the flow: look up how the model works.
